What companies run services between Seekonk, MA, USA and Boston Logan Airport Terminal C, MA, USA?

MBTA operates a train from Providence to South Station hourly. Tickets cost $5–14 and the journey takes 1h 15m.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Waterman after State to Logan International Airport via Kennedy Plaza, N Main after Church, Providence, and Boston in around 3h 8m.
